In this article, we will focus our attention on the so-called Diario de Bordeaux, which Antonieta Rivas Mercado kept during her stay in that city in southwestern France and whose period covers October 12, 1930, to February 7, 1931. Although the first diary entry is recorded on November 6, 1930, and the last one on January 23, 1931, thus, only 22 days of that period of reinvention and distancing from Mexico seemed to be threatening. Through the writer's diary entries, we intend to sketch a map of the intellectual process that would lead her to explore the topics she wanted to write about, plan her next years of life, and structure future works.
